Xshell无法ping通虚拟机的原因及解决方法
- 综合资讯
- 2024-11-07 16:47:42
- 1

Xshell无法ping通虚拟机可能是由于网络设置或防火墙问题。解决方法包括:检查虚拟机网络设置,确保虚拟网络与主机网络互通;关闭虚拟机防火墙或调整防火墙规则;检查主机...
Xshell无法ping通虚拟机可能是由于网络设置或防火墙问题。解决方法包括:检查虚拟机网络设置,确保虚拟网络与主机网络互通;关闭虚拟机防火墙或调整防火墙规则;检查主机网络配置,确保网络畅通。
随着虚拟技术的不断发展,越来越多的用户开始使用虚拟机来满足各种工作需求,在使用过程中,可能会遇到Xshell无法ping通虚拟机的问题,本文将针对这一问题,分析原因并给出相应的解决方法。
Xshell无法ping通虚拟机的原因
1、网络配置错误
网络配置错误是导致Xshell无法ping通虚拟机的主要原因之一,以下是一些可能出现的网络配置错误:
(1)虚拟机网络适配器未开启或未连接到正确的网络。
(2)虚拟机IP地址、子网掩码、默认网关配置错误。
(3)物理主机网络配置错误,如路由器设置不当。
2、虚拟机防火墙设置
虚拟机安装了防火墙,且防火墙规则阻止了ping命令的发送或接收。
3、物理主机防火墙设置
物理主机安装了防火墙,且防火墙规则阻止了虚拟机与物理主机之间的通信。
4、网络设备故障
网络设备(如交换机、路由器等)出现故障,导致网络不通。
5、虚拟机操作系统故障
虚拟机操作系统出现故障,如系统文件损坏、驱动程序错误等。
二、Xshell无法ping通虚拟机的解决方法
1、检查网络配置
(1)确保虚拟机网络适配器已开启,并连接到正确的网络。
(2)检查虚拟机的IP地址、子网掩码、默认网关配置是否正确,若不正确,请修改为正确的配置。
(3)检查物理主机网络配置是否正确,若不正确,请修改为正确的配置。
2、检查防火墙设置
(1)检查虚拟机防火墙设置,确保ping命令未被阻止。
(2)检查物理主机防火墙设置,确保ping命令未被阻止。
3、检查网络设备
(1)检查网络设备(如交换机、路由器等)是否正常工作。
(2)检查物理主机与虚拟机之间的物理连接是否正常。
4、重启虚拟机
有时,重启虚拟机可以解决网络不通的问题。
5、重装操作系统
如果以上方法都无法解决问题,可能需要重装虚拟机操作系统。
预防措施
1、在配置虚拟机网络时,仔细检查各项设置,确保无误。
2、定期检查网络设备,确保其正常工作。
3、避免在虚拟机中安装过多防火墙软件,以免造成冲突。
4、定期备份虚拟机,以防操作系统故障导致数据丢失。
Xshell无法ping通虚拟机的问题可能由多种原因引起,通过分析原因,采取相应的解决方法,可以有效解决这个问题,在日常使用过程中,注意预防措施,可以有效避免此类问题的发生。
本文链接:https://www.zhitaoyun.cn/655274.html
发表评论